A collection of nine TOMY CHUNKY CHANGER VEHICLES from the 1980's. These toys are stylishly designed basic pre-school transformers, simple 'puzzles' which convert from geometric shapes to simple vehicles with a few basic adjustments. I think these are examples of all the vehicles TOMY made minus one, a dumper truck. They were ll sld individually I think, but may have also been sold later in packs of two or three durng their life, I can't quite recall.
